Q: Is 4,615,144 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,615,144 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,615,144 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4615144 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 281 562 1,124 2,053 2,248 4,106 8,212 16,424 576,893 1,153,786 2,307,572 and 4,615,144, with no remainder.

Since 4,615,144 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,615,144, it is not a prime number.
